How to Fit NeoTimber® Straight Balustrade Rails on a Level Surface
Installing composite balustrade straight railings starts with accurate post positioning and a suitable supporting base. This guide follows the NeoTimber® assembly sequence, from setting out the post mounts to fitting the rails, aluminium balusters and finishing pieces.
Use the steps and diagrams below to install composite balustrade straight railings on a straight, level run. Read them alongside the current composite balustrade installation instructions supplied for your product. Stair sections require their own configuration and fitting method.
Before You Begin
- Confirm the layout, finished height and suitability of the complete balustrade for the intended location.
- Check that post mounts can be fixed to a suitable supporting structure. Decking boards alone are not the structural fixing base.
- Use the fixing method specified for your substrate; do not assume a screw shown in a diagram suits every base.
- Identify the supplied components, straight-railing template and fixings before starting.
- Have measuring tools, a level, suitable drill and bits, screw-driving equipment and cutting tools appropriate to the composite rails and metal inserts available.
- Use appropriate protective equipment when drilling and cutting, and check for concealed services before drilling the base.
The measurements below relate to the system illustrated. Check them against the instructions for the components you receive before drilling or cutting.
Step 1: Set Out the Post Mounts
Mark the positions for post mounts J-LV-0215-36. For the illustrated system, the maximum spacing is 1,910mm centre to centre, as shown in diagram 1. Check the full layout before fixing the mounts.

Step 2: Secure the Mounts and Fit the Sleeves
Install the post mounts using the fixing method appropriate to the supporting base. Diagram 2 identifies screw WJ0133 in the illustrated arrangement; confirm its applicability to your substrate. Slide post sleeve N-JM088 over each mount as shown in diagram 3.

Step 3: Mark and Pre-Drill the Bracket Positions
Use the supplied “Straight Railing” cardboard template to mark the post-bracket positions, following diagrams 4 and 5. Use the designated top-bracket marks and the bottom two holes for the lower brackets. Set the template from the ground-level reference to the top of its indicated line, as directed by the supplied instructions. Pre-drill the bracket holes with a 3mm bit.

Step 4: Fit the Post Skirts and Brackets
Lower post skirt K-LV-0199 over sleeve N-JM088, as shown in diagram 6. Secure the upper post brackets D-R0211 with screws WJ0130, following diagram 7. Secure the lower post brackets G-R0205 with screws WJ0131, following diagram 8.


Step 5: Measure and Cut the Rails if Required
The straight rails in this guide are supplied at a standard length of 1,810mm. If the opening requires a shorter rail, remove galvanised insert B-LV-0209 before cutting composite rail A-JM087.
- Measure the clear distance between the post sleeves.
- Cut the composite rail to that distance minus 3mm at each end, allowing for gaskets FR0102, as shown in diagram 9.
- Cut the galvanised insert 6mm shorter than the cut composite rail.
- Retain at least 75mm between each rail end and its first baluster hole, following the measurement shown in diagram 10.
Check both ends before cutting. If the required opening cannot be achieved while retaining the specified end distances, resolve the layout with the supplier before proceeding.


Step 6: Attach the Bottom Rail Brackets
Fit bottom rail brackets H-R0204 using screws WJ0020. Follow the 29.5mm and 24mm locating dimensions shown in diagram 11; refer to the diagram for their precise orientation. The original method also allows a flat board against the rail end to help position the bracket correctly.

Step 7: Fit the Foot Blocks and Check Rail Orientation
Pre-drill and attach foot blocks I-LV-0216 to the bottom rail using screws WJ0020, as shown in diagram 12. Space them evenly for the finished rail length and do not position them beneath a pre-drilled baluster hole.
Check the rail orientation before assembly: the top rail holes face downwards and the bottom rail holes face upwards, as illustrated in diagram 13.


Step 8: Position the Bottom Rail
Attach bottom rail A-JM087 to lower post brackets G-R0205, following diagram 14. Check that the rail is seated in the intended position before adding the infill.

Step 9: Insert the Baluster Plugs and Aluminium Balusters
Install baluster plugs E-LV-0218-B and aluminium balusters M-LV-0218-A-36 in the pre-formed positions, as shown in diagram 15. Follow the illustrated arrangement without changing the spindle layout.

Step 10: Attach the Galvanised Adaptors
Fit galvanised adaptors C-LV-0210 to both ends of galvanised insert B-LV-0209, as shown in diagram 16.

Step 11: Slide the Insert into the Top Rail
Slide the assembled galvanised insert B-LV-0209 into top rail A-JM087, following diagram 17.

Step 12: Fit the Top Rail
Position top rail A-JM087 onto upper post brackets D-R0211, as shown in diagram 18. Check that the balusters engage correctly with the top rail as the assembly is brought together.

Step 13: Secure the Rail Assembly
Pre-drill and secure the assembly using screws WJ0142 at the positions shown in diagram 19. Follow the supplied instructions for the drilling and fastening details.

Step 14: Fit the Post Caps and Gaskets
Attach post caps L-LV-0120 and gaskets F-R0102 as illustrated in diagram 20. The source instructions also refer to the gaskets as FR0102 in the cutting step; check these references against the supplied component list.

Step 15: Adjust the Foot Blocks
If required, adjust foot blocks I-LV-0216 to the correct height, following diagram 21. Complete the final checks specified in the installation instructions before the balustrade is used.

Final Installation Checks
Check the post connections, rail fixings, baluster seating and foot-block adjustment against the supplied instructions. Confirm that the completed arrangement matches the project specification. Investigate any movement, missing fixing or damaged component before allowing the balustrade to be used.
Installing Composite Balustrade Straight Railings: FAQs
What is the maximum post spacing?
The illustrated system specifies a maximum of 1,910mm between post-mount centres. This is not the clear opening between the post sleeves. Confirm the dimensions for your supplied system before setting out.
How much allowance should I leave when cutting the rails?
For the illustrated system, deduct 3mm at each end from the clear distance between sleeves. Cut the galvanised insert 6mm shorter than the composite rail, and retain the specified minimum 75mm distance from each rail end to its first baluster hole.
Should the metal insert be removed before cutting?
Yes. The supplied sequence requires removal of the galvanised insert before cutting the composite rail. Cut each material using the appropriate equipment and refit the insert as directed.
Which way should the rail holes face?
The top rail holes face downwards, while the bottom rail holes face upwards, so the balusters fit between them.
Can I use this method on stairs?
This guide covers straight, level railing runs. Follow the separate stair installation instructions and use the components specified for that configuration.
Can the posts be anchored to decking boards alone?
No. Use the specified connection to a suitable supporting structure or approved base. Select the post-fixing method for the actual substrate.
